## Improvements

- Updated description of VariableSizeModule (thanks LeeSpork)

## Bug fixes

- Make `GetPlanet` only check planets in the current system. This
prevents it from pulling the wrong config if a planet in another system
has the same name (thanks coderCleric).
- Fixed interaction volumes breaking when no shape provided.
- Added an effect ruleset to sand. Fixes #1099
